作业帮 > 综合 > 作业

怎样才能让CS起源里的枪械射出的子弹跟求生之路里的一样带可见弹道(或者说子弹飞行轨迹)?

来源:学生作业帮 编辑:搜狗做题网作业帮 分类:综合作业 时间:2024/08/13 14:53:25
怎样才能让CS起源里的枪械射出的子弹跟求生之路里的一样带可见弹道(或者说子弹飞行轨迹)?
CS1.5 1.6里面可以通过装MOD插件实现可见子弹飞行轨迹,CS起源版好像也有类似的版本不知道是在哪里玩过,前段时间在玩Left 4 Dead和Half Life 2EP2时就觉的里面的子弹飞行的曳光效果很有意思,对比两者之间的武器脚本差异,只有一点点不同,但是不敢确定是通过改脚本还是改Dll或建模文件文件,所以很想知道这个视觉效果这么才能在CS起源里通过修改脚本实现.
具体点在哪里下载插件?是FPSBANANA还是别的什么地方,下载什么样的插件(插件名称)才可以实现可见弹道?
怎样才能让CS起源里的枪械射出的子弹跟求生之路里的一样带可见弹道(或者说子弹飞行轨迹)?
别想了,加不了的,如果你看过这几个游戏的源代码你会发现,要加个弹道特效根本不是装个插件就行的事,而是要重新编写近半部分的游戏代码,你要说换个皮肤,这可以,因为原本就有,我们要做的是替换,而弹道的显示,是CSS原本没有的,你现在要做的就好比让一只公鸡给你下一个蛋,他没那功能,你就是逼死他,他也做不到不是.
我看了HL2和CSS的源代码(L4D的没有)枪械方面的关联有很多,包括枪口火花、枪械抖动、枪械皮肤、枪械声音、着弹点等虽然各自都是独立的,但都是相互关联的,如果要重新编写其中一个(注意我说的是重新编写而不是替换),就要重新编写全部,而且CS系列的所有游戏在从主菜单到进入游戏的那个等待的过程中,游戏的主程会对素材进行检测,新加的文件(原本没有的)很可能无法通过检测,虽然检测能关掉,但会造成游戏不稳定
我曾尝试过像游戏中加入新枪(呵呵,火焰喷射器,设成B61),不过没成功,整个游戏都没法玩了(根本无法进入),也许是技术不够好吧,
没有讽刺你的意思,毕竟我也有过这个想法,也许真的是我技术不好、也没有耐心,自己没做成、也没找到,你如果真的找到,就在百度上告诉我吧,
...只是想说,技术上、理论上,真的不可能成功,祝愿你真的找到